If you used to collect baseball cards, and perhaps have a box of old baseball cards that is taking up space in your house, you may have thought of simply throwing the box out - or, if you have been thinking creatively, you may have thought of listing the whole box on eBay and seeing what someone is willing to pay for it; but if you are willing to take just a bit of time to sort through these cards yourself, you might actually find that you will be able to sell some of them for a lot more money than you could possibly fetch from just listing the whole box. When you organize your baseball cards in order to sell them, the first thing you'll need to do is sort the cards by the manufacturer; if you are lucky, you may already have your cards sorted this way, but more than likely you have the cards sorted by position, or by team, or even alphabetically, and will need to carefully go through them to sort the cards anew. As you take the time to sort your cards by manufacturer, it will also be good for you to be on the lookout for any cards that stand out to you as ones that might be valuable; of course, the condition of the card will be a big element, but also realize that well-known players - especially rookie cards of well-known players - will tend to sell for a lot more than cards of players who were not well known, even if these cards are not quite in perfect condition. And once you have sorted and organized your cards and are finally ready to sell them, start looking more closely at places such as Amazon and eBay to figure out which will be the best match for the cards you have, or you can even approach a local card store; before you set any prices, however, make sure you do a bit of research, picking up a sports book that lists basic values for different cards, as this will help you to make sure you are getting the most out of the cards you have. Following these steps to sell your cards takes only a little bit of extra time and effort, and when you do this, you may just find that you are able to get a lot more money than you would otherwise have been able to.
